Define and run multi-container applications with Docker
Go to file
Guillaume Tardif 01ea2488a2
Merge pull request #630 from docker/cli_metrics_failures
Cli metrics failures
2020-09-18 18:26:54 +02:00
.github Adding badge for cloud integration tests. 2020-09-17 12:19:04 +02:00
aci Add status field in API metrics 2020-09-18 15:22:34 +02:00
api Merge pull request #598 from docker/encode_env_values 2020-09-10 17:17:02 +02:00
backend Adding volume API & initial CLI command 2020-09-08 15:30:50 +02:00
cli Add status field in API metrics 2020-09-18 15:22:34 +02:00
config Rename docker/api -> docker/compose-cli 2020-08-21 17:28:39 +02:00
context Allow running commands with HOME=“”. 2020-09-17 09:08:17 +02:00
docs In version, replace “Azure integration” version info by “Cloud integration” 2020-09-11 17:29:40 +02:00
ecs Merge pull request #630 from docker/cli_metrics_failures 2020-09-18 18:26:54 +02:00
errdefs Add status field in API metrics 2020-09-18 15:22:34 +02:00
example Adding volume API & initial CLI command 2020-09-08 15:30:50 +02:00
formatter formatter,multierror,progress: Move to gotest.tools 2020-08-04 13:53:54 +02:00
local Connecting it all 2020-09-08 15:30:50 +02:00
metrics We can’t anymore “fire and forget”, now that metrics get posted right at the end, most of the time we’d loose them. 2020-09-18 15:57:02 +02:00
progress Progress functions can return a string, that can be used in the caller of progress.Run to display final result after progress display 2020-09-14 14:29:03 +02:00
prompt Update or add license header which are not valid 2020-08-17 16:55:25 +02:00
protos Add 'kill' command 2020-09-04 02:57:54 +02:00
scripts Fix linux script parsing version to check if we have the new CLI already installed or not (need to keep azure check for users who have the previous version installed :/ ) 2020-09-14 16:59:56 +02:00
server Add status field in API metrics 2020-09-18 15:22:34 +02:00
tests Changing e2e test PATH to make windows tests pass 2020-09-17 17:13:05 +02:00
utils Move containers, compose, secrets to /api 2020-09-07 13:22:08 +02:00
.dockerignore Add .git to .dockerignore 2020-05-29 11:29:28 +02:00
.gitattributes Removed test requiring linux containers 2020-06-11 12:58:58 +02:00
.gitignore Remove non-project path 2020-04-24 14:04:27 +02:00
.golangci.yml Extract interface / types to allow unit tests / mock 2020-05-15 10:15:56 +02:00
BUILDING.md readme: Minor fixes 2020-09-01 11:51:56 +02:00
CHANGELOG.md Rename docker/api -> docker/compose-cli 2020-08-21 17:28:39 +02:00
CONTRIBUTING.md contributing: Tidy and clarify 2020-09-03 15:54:20 +02:00
Dockerfile deps: Bump Golang to 1.15.2, golangci-lint to 1.31.0 2020-09-14 17:23:18 +02:00
INSTALL.md In version, replace “Azure integration” version info by “Cloud integration” 2020-09-11 17:29:40 +02:00
LICENSE Add LICENSE and NOTICE files 2020-08-17 10:20:49 +02:00
MAINTAINERS Signed-off-by: Guillaume Tardif <guillaume.tardif@docker.com> 2020-08-26 10:50:12 +02:00
Makefile Remove dependabot and add a check-dependencies command in make file 2020-08-26 09:54:01 +02:00
NOTICE Add LICENSE and NOTICE files 2020-08-17 10:20:49 +02:00
README.md Adding badge for cloud integration tests. 2020-09-17 12:19:04 +02:00
builder.Makefile Add import restrictions check 2020-08-19 12:31:30 +02:00
go.mod Introduce support for external EFS volumes 2020-09-15 13:03:53 +02:00
go.sum Introduce support for external EFS volumes 2020-09-15 13:03:53 +02:00
import-restrictions.yaml Rename docker/api -> docker/compose-cli 2020-08-21 17:28:39 +02:00

README.md

Docker Compose CLI

Actions Status Actions Status

This CLI tool makes it easy to run containers in the cloud using either Amazon Elastic Container Service (ECS) or Microsoft Azure Container Instances (ACI) using the Docker commands you already know.

To get started, all you need is:

⚠️ This CLI is currently in beta please create issues to leave feedback

Examples

Development

See the instructions in BUILDING.md for how to build the CLI and run its tests; including the end to end tests for local containers, ACI, and ECS. The guide also includes instructions for releasing the CLI.

Before contributing, please read the contribution guidelines which includes conventions used in this project.